Description: This end-terraced house is situated on Rinkfield to the south east of the town centre in a level and convenient location for shops, post office, schools, Dr's surgery the Kendal Leisure Centre and on a local bus route. Offering an easy to manage layout with a living room and fitted kitchen, two good double bedrooms and bathroom. Recently improved with neutral decoration throughout and new carpets and floor coverings laid.

There is potential for off road parking to the front and the paved garden to the rear overlooks a playing field and small children's play area. A home that is ready for the new owners to move into being ideal for the first time buyer or for those seeking an investment property that is a turn key for the letting market - with no upward chain and early possession available the next step is an appointment to view.  

Location: Location: Rinkfield is situated in a convenient location just off Burton Road in Kendal, close to the Kendal Leisure Centre, Kirkbie Kendal School and Rinkfield post office and store.

Take the right turning into Rinkfield by the post office and follow the road down and number 68 can then be found on your left hand side.  

Property Overview: A red brick and rendered end of terraced property that is located in a popular location, within easy walking of many local amenities including primary and secondary schools, shops, a post office and Kendal leisure centre.

The property benefits from gas central heating and double glazing and has recently been decorated throughout with new carpets and floor coverings laid. Outside is paved garden to the rear and the potential for off road parking to the front.

The layout is easy to manage with the entrance hall with staircase to the first floor. Just off the hall is a light and airy living room which overlooks the front from a large picture window. Attractive fireplace with polished inset and hearth and living flame gas fire.

Folding doors open into the kitchen with a part glazed door and two windows. Fitted with an attractive range of timber wall and base units with complementary working surfaces, inset bowl and half stainless steel sink and co-ordinating part tiled walls and pelmet lighting. Built in oven and four ring electric hob with cooker hood and extractor over. Space for fridge freezer and plumbing for washing machine. Useful under stairs cupboard with Ideal gas boiler.

The first floor landing has a window to the side and opens into the bedrooms and bathroom.

Bedroom one on the front enjoys an open aspect across to Scout Scar and has a large walk-in wardrobe with window and a deep over stairs cupboard.

Bedroom two to the rear overlooks the play park and playing field.

The bathroom has a three piece suite with a shower over the bath, attractive tiled walls and flooring and a chrome towel radiator.

    The Kendal office of Hackney & Leigh enjoys a prominent position on Stricklandgate at the heart of the historic market town of Kendal. The town’s unique blend of history, culture and shopping make it a very popular destination for visitors. The office was opened in August 1982 by John Leigh & Derrick Hackney having been bought from Derrick’s father and uncle – D & J Hackney who since 1947 had run their own greengrocers business from the premises with some of the fruit and vegetables being grown at the rear on what is now the office car park. The office is constantly busy having both successful sales and lettings departments run buy a team of 8 long standing members of staff.     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
